■(TB) 'High Contrast'

1987, Robarts

'High Contrast' (Evelyn Robarts, R. 1987). Seedling# 7-9-1. TB, 40" (102 cm), Midseason bloom. Standards light violet blue; falls very pale violet blue; light orange beard; ruffled; slight fragrance. ('Christmas Time' x 'Pink Sleigh') X 'Sea Lure'. Stahly 1987.

References:

From AIS Bulletin #265 April 1987 Introducing HIGH CONTRAST (Robarts '87) TB, 40", M. Light violet-blue standards, very pale violet-blue falls fading to white; light orange beards. Good stalks with excellent bud placement produce 7-9 large well-formed blooms. This is a striking very contrasty reverse amoena. Fertile. Sdlg. 7-9-1: (Christmas Time x Pink Sleigh) X Sea Lure. $25.00. Harold Stahly.
